Bassline SUMMER celebrates the end of the year, time to have fun and let go, with the best of Mzansi talent from our most shining stars to our rising stars in the making!
See Headline artist Samthing Soweto, Urban-Soul singer-songwriter Langa Mavuso, Pop-trio Beatenberg with special guests Msaki & Tresor as part of their homecoming tour. The lineup is further strengthened with LaliBoi and renowned producer Spoek Mathambo who create a unique and vital blend of Hip-hop, Jazz and South African tribal music, their performance is thanks to the support of Concerts SA and their partners The Royal Norwegian Embassy, SAMRO & IKS Cultural Consulting.
The addition of Langa Mavuso & Beatenberg really takes the Bassline SUMMER into the next level of live music enjoyment.
BEATENBERG are excited to be performing at Bassline SUMMER as part of their homecoming tour, in support of their new EP entitled ‘ON THE WAY TO BEATENBERG’, which is the musical stalwarts’ first new offering in 4 years. Having just completed UK dates with George Ezra, the band set off on a sold out headline tour on 14 November at Rockwood Music Hall in New York before heading to LA, Paris, Berlin, Amsterdam, London, Johannesburg and Cape Town. They have also just been announced as part of the first 191 artists scheduled for SXSW 2023.
Self-produced by the trio, BEATENBERG already started writing the EP in the Southern Hemisphere since the summer of 2018/2019. At first they had no plan to release it, but got back into the songs earlier in 2022. The band recorded the EP at Sunset Recording Studios outside Stellenbosch, with a few additions in Cape Town.

The outcome of the call for applications for female lead bands/artists has added two wonderful fresh talents; Melo B Jones and Rah Punzl. Melo B Jones describes her music as Boom-Bap-Soul, while Rah Punzl is a Fresh Find" from RnB Soul, Trap-soul and Afro House.
The Creative Uprising market will ensure that you will not go hungry and the bars on site will refresh ones thirst while digesting the hottest talent on offer. Arts & Crafts stalls will also be available to shop from.
This year Bassline SUMMER falls part of Johannesburg’s annual Arts Alive Festival." Says Bassline Live's Brad Holmes. The City of Joburg, through the Arts Alive International Arts Festival and other initiatives, continues to support the creative sector and expand its reach and impact through partnerships. In celebration of the 30th edition of the Arts Alive International Festival 2022, the Arts Alive Festival will present a variety of artistic programmes featuring artists from various sectors of the creative industries through cultural activities which includes music, fashion, craft, comedy, dance, theatre, visual art and cultural educational workshops.
